“Born in Kingsfield, Texas, Hernandez was the youngest of 10 brothers and sisters - five girls and five boys.
Her parents, Emilio and Santos Treviño, had migrated to Texas from Nuevo Leon, Mexico, in 1907, working as cotton pickers. Eventually Emilio was able to become a crew leader.
On their trips to work in Minnesota, Illinois and Michigan, the family sometimes slept in the back of Emilio’s truck.”
